I find the most economical are the flat nappies that you fold... depending on the way you fold them they will last from birth to age 2 (and beyond if you have a small child). With the fitted ones they grow out of them PLUS they are more expensive per nappy.

I agree: a combination of cloth during the day and an Aldi disposable at night is the best in terms of economy IMO. And remember if you use a good qulaity laundry powder like Drive or OMO sensitive then you wont need NapiSan.
